I’m a therapist with 25+ years in human services, and I specialize in helping people navigate anxiety, trauma, and life transitions. My approach My style is warm, collaborative, and grounded in CBT and trauma-informed practices. I believe therapy should feel like a conversation—not a lecture—and I tailor each session to meet your unique needs. My focus I use a trauma-informed lens and CBT techniques to help clients shift unhelpful patterns and build resilience. I work best with those who value honesty, reflection, and growth. My communication style I would describe my communication style as direct yet gentle—always guided by empathy and curiosity. My journey to mental healthcare My own path to becoming a therapist was driven by a passion for understanding people and helping them thrive. My goals for you I’ve spent more than two decades supporting individuals and families through life’s most challenging moments. I specialize in helping people navigate anxiety, trauma, and life transitions. My first session with you In our first session, we’ll take time to get to know each other, clarify your goals, and begin laying the foundation for your healing journey. Also in our first session, expect a calm, welcoming environment where we’ll talk about what brings you here and how we can work together to create meaningful change.
